اذهب الي المحتوي
أوفيسنا

عمل ترحيل للبيانات بشروط لعدد من الشيتات


الردود الموصى بها

السلام عليكم ورحمة الله وبركاته

 

الاخوة الافاضل  والاساتذه الكرام

 

لدي عدد كبير من الفواتير والسندات والتي ارغب  بجمعها

 

وقد عملت ملف بالمطلوب

 

صفحة ادخال البيانات متتالية  ثم اقوم بترحيلها دفعة واحدة  لان عدد المستفيدين كثر

 

ولكن وجد صعوبه بالفكرة التي لدي  لانها تحتاج ثلاث شروط

 

النوع   --   الفرع  --  المستفيد

 

والصفحة التي تنقل اليها ليست بنفس التنسيق

 

اتمنى اني اجد الاجابة  لاني محتاجها ضروري  بسبب كثرة الفواتير والسندات الموجوده

 

واذا وجدت فكرة افضل مما عملته

 

فمنكم استفيد ولكم الشكر والتقدير  مقدماَ

 

 

دمتم بخير

 

 

 

 

حسابات.rar

رابط هذا التعليق
شارك

لم اعتقد انك نسيت

 

لاني اعرف اانك مشغول ولديك اعمال اهم

 

ومجهود رائع ومشكور علية

 

ولكن

 

ليس هذا المقصود فلقد عملت بالدالة vlookup  وهي تنقل البيانات مباشرة للجهة المحددة

 

وعند مسح البيانات من نموذج الادخال تنمسح من الجهة المرحل اليها

 

 

وانا اريد صفحة الادخال  للبيانات ثم ترحل كل الى جهة وجهتها  ويتم مسح بيانات صفحة الادخال

 

لاخال بيانات جديدة 

 

 

ولك مني الشكر

رابط هذا التعليق
شارك

اخى العزيز

 

والله فعلت كل ما بوسعى ما توصلت إلا لهذا الحل غير المكتمل

 

ولكن ان شاء الله يكتمل على يد الاخوة الاعضاء بالمنتدى

 

ملخص الفكرة

 

هو انك لن تمسح البيانات التى ادخلتها فى صفحة الادخال

 

بل ستكون هناك 12 صفحة ادخال يناير - فبراير - مارس ...ألخ

 

ومن صفحة التقرير تختار كشف حساب من تريد وايضا اى شهر

 

واذا اعجبتك الفكرة وقبلت تفيذها على هذا الوضع + توصلنا الى تكملة المعادلات ( معادلات الترحيل عند السحب لاسفل لم تأتى بالنتيجة المرجوة )

 

ان شاء الله ستكون هناك افكار اخرى كثيرة تضاف الى ملفك

 

قلت لك قبل سابق ان لى ملف مثلة تقريبا

 

ووفقنا الله الى ما يحبة ويرضاة 

الاب الروحى if and.rar

الاب الروحى sumifs.rar

رابط هذا التعليق
شارك

 اخي العزيز

 

من كل قلبي اشكرك

 

لاتساع صدرك ووقتك لموضوعي وإهتمامك به  الذي يعكس طيبتك وحبك للخير إن شاء الله

 

الموضع الذي اود ان اصل اليه

 

يوجد لدي بيانات مدخلة من السابق على نفس التنسيق , وارغب في التكمله على نفس التنسيق

 

ولكن لتوقفي عن عمليات الادخال لفترة طويلة وجدت ان لدي فواتير وسندات كثيرة جداً

 

واجد صعوبه في التنقل بين الشيتات التي تبلغ تقريبا 70 - 80 ورقة

 

وفكرة العمل كما يلي

 

1- الورقة الاولى  والتي بها النموذج الذي يتم إدخال البيانات حسب ماهو مخطط له .

 

2- عند اكتمال الجدول او انتهاء عملية الادخال يتم ترحيلها الى كل شيت يحمل الاسماء ( المستفيد ).

 

3- بعد عملية الترحيل يمسح الجدول لادخال بيانات أُخرى .

 

 

لقد وجدت اكواد ترحيل ولكن للاسف لم استطع تركبها على النحو الذي ارغب به لاداء عملي

 

لقلة خبرتي بالاكواد ( vb ) .

 

اتمنى ان الفكرة وصلت

 

 

وشكرا لكم مرة اخرى

 

وحتى لو لم اجد الحل الذي ارغب به

 

اقول  شكرا شكرا شكرا  لانكم حاولتو  ولكن المشكلة منى بحيث انني لم استطع ايصال المعلومة

 

كما يريدها صناع البرامج .

 

 

دمتم بخير وسعادة .

رابط هذا التعليق
شارك

اخى العزيز

 

انشاأت موضوع لتكملة المعادلات التى لم تكتمل

 

وان شاء الله تكتمل

 

وحينها تظهر لك الفكرة كاملة من الواقع العملى وترى مدى ايجابية هذة الطريقة

 

ولكن ان لم تقتنع فأنا ان شاء الله سأحاول معك الحل بلأكواد برغم انى جديد فى الحل بها

 

ولكن هنا اعضاء ماشاء الله عليهم فى الاكواد والمعادلات

 

وان شاء الله تجد ضالتك

رابط هذا التعليق
شارك

اخى العزيز

 

والله فعلت كل ما بوسعى ما توصلت إلا لهذا الحل غير المكتمل

 

ولكن ان شاء الله يكتمل على يد الاخوة الاعضاء بالمنتدى

 

 

 

شكرا ثم شكرا ثم شكرا

 

 

 

ان الاسم يدل على واقعك الجميل بحبك للخير وعطائك الا محدوووود

 

 

اولا اتمنى ان تقبلني صديق حتى لو لم اصل الى حل

 

 

ثانيا ارفق لك الملف لعلني اوصل الفكرة

 

 

 

اتمنى لكم التوفيق

تم تعديل بواسطه ksaa
رابط هذا التعليق
شارك

الاخ يوسف

 

شكرا لك ولما قمت به

 

لكن مشكلتي بإستخدام الاكواد  لكي احدد له

 

من اين يبدأ واين ينتهي

 

الاعمدة والصفوف التي ارغب بترحيلها

 

الشيت المرحل الية 

 

من اين يبدأ اللصق 

 

وهل اختلاف  موقع الاعمدة او الصفوف له تأثير على الكود

 

 

وكذلك عندما لا تكون الخلايا متجاورة

 

وفي عملية اللصق ( الترحيل )  هل ترتيب الخلايا ضروري او انني احدد الخلايا التى ارغب

 

 

دمتم بخير وسعادة جميعاً

رابط هذا التعليق
شارك

السلام عليكم

 

تم عمل فورم لانشاء ورقة باسم الحساب يتضمن الاسم مع رقم الفرع

 

علشان تكون التسمية والورقة على نسق واحد

 

وتم عمل كود للترحيل

 

شاهد المرفق 2010

 

 

 

الحسابات 1.rar

  • Like 2
رابط هذا التعليق
شارك

السلام عليكم

 

شكرا والف شكر لـــإـ  ستاذنا ومديرنا عبدالله باقشير

 

لعل الخطأ كان مني فانا اعتذر لسيادتك

 

 

اما الامر الاخر عند اضافة حساب جديد  لا استطيع بمعنى لا يقبل الا الموجود سابقاً

 

 

وهناك سؤال آخر هل استطيع نقل الكود الى ملف آخر لاكمال إدخال البيانات  على ما هو موجود سابقاً

 

 

 

اتمنى الافادة مع وافتر التحية والتقدير

 

لك ولكل من ساهم او حاول او اطلع

 

ابو فيصل

رابط هذا التعليق
شارك

وعليكم السلام

 

اما الامر الاخر عند اضافة حساب جديد  لا استطيع بمعنى لا يقبل الا الموجود سابقاً

 

 

اضف التسميات الجديدة الى القائمة اسماء الشركات والموسسات

وعند فتح الفورم ستظهر لك الاسماء المضافة

لان لازم تكون التسمية ماخوذة من القائمة علشان انت تستخدم هذه القائمة في صفحة الترحيل عمود المستفيد

 

وهناك سؤال آخر هل استطيع نقل الكود الى ملف آخر لاكمال إدخال البيانات  على ما هو موجود سابقاً

 

 

لازم تكون الاورق في الملف بنفس ما هي عليه في هذا الملف

يعني مواقع الاعمدة تكون نفسها وما في اي صفوف فاضية بين تسميات رؤوس الاعمدة والجدول

مثل ماهو معمول في ملفك السابق

 

تحياتي

رابط هذا التعليق
شارك

استاذي عبدالله

 

الف شكر لك وتقدير على ردك وتحملك استفساراتي

 

ولكن لا أجد الا قول

 

الله يجزاك الخير وأن يغفر ذنبي وذنبك وذنب كل مسلم ومسلمة الاحياء منهم والاموات

 

سأحاول تطبيق ما قلت وإذا واجهتني أي معوقات سوف اطرحها بالمنتدى

 

وتقبل تحياتي

رابط هذا التعليق
شارك

  • 2 weeks later...

السلام عليكم

 

الاخ عبدالله باقشير

 

جزاك الله الخير

 

الطلب الاول

 

ان هناك فواتير كاش وأخرى آجل وتكون مشتركة بين الفروع

 

كيف يتم اضافتها للفروع دفعة واحدة

 

بمعنى

 

فاتوره ---- الرقم -------- التاريخ ------- المبلغ الاجمالي ------ فرع 1  -------  فرع 2 ---------- فرع 3

 

كاش ----- 1234 ---- 1 - 1 - 2013 ------- 6500 ----------- 2500 --------  1500 ------------- 2500

 

كاش -----12345----2 - 1 - 2013 ---------2200 ------------1800 ------------------------------- 400

 

آجل ------4561 ---- 1 - 1 - 2013 -------- 3000 --------------------------- 1500 -------------1500

 

آجل ------4598 ---- 6 - 1 - 2013 -------- 8000 ------------2700--------- 4000 -------------1300

 

اتمنى ان الامو واضح لهذه النقطة

 

 

الامر الاخر

 

اريد كود يجمع الخلية رقم 10 من كل صفحات العملاء  في خلية اريد تحديدها

 

العميل ---- المجموع ---  رقم الخلية

محمد 1---  c10 ----   4444

محمد 2--- c10 ----    3426

محمد 3--- c10   ---- 4562

----         c10 ----

----         c10 ----

محمد ؟--- c10  ---- 3400

 

 

وإذا اختلف موقع الخلية

 

مثلا ورقة 1 خلية رقم d2  ورقة 2 خلية رقم b3 ورقة 3 خلية رقم f7

 

هل بالامكان ان اجمعها بالكود

 

 

الشكر والتقدير لك اخ عبدالله

 

وعذرا على كثرة الاستفسارات

 

دمت بخير وسعادة دائمتين

 

 

رابط هذا التعليق
شارك

السلام عليكم

 

عملية الترحيل تتم مرة واحدة لكل صف من ورقة الترحيل

الى الورقة الماخوذ اسمها من ( عمود المستفيد+الفرع)

 

اذا كانت المشتركة لثلاثة حسابات حتعملها على ثلاثة صفوف

 

اين المشكلة في ذلك ؟؟؟

رابط هذا التعليق
شارك

عملت مثل ما قلت ثلاث اسطر وتم الترحيل

 

باقي عملية الجمع

 

جميع الاوراق الخلية c1  اريد ان تجمع في ورقة المجموع في خلية مثلا  d7  بالكود

 

وامر اخر القائمة المنسدلة اريدها عند كتابة اول حرف من الكلمة تظهر بدون البحث كل مرة بالقائمة كاملة

 

 

شكرا لك  ولتقبلك اسئلتي

رابط هذا التعليق
شارك

هنا ما اريد حتى الان

 

 

واتمنى ان يكون واضح

 

هناك امر آخر وهو انه يوجد لدي تاريخ هجري وقد حاولت بالتنسيق

 

عندما اكتب التاريخ ثم تاب ان يتحول الى ميلادى كما بالسياق

 

لان الحسابات لدي بالميلادي

 

الامر  المهم لدي ترتيب التاريخ  بحيث يكون من الاقدم الى الاحدث أو العكس ( تفيد في المراجعة فيما بعد )

 

للفواتير  والسندات كلٍ على قائمتة ( العمود الخاص به )

 

 

 

 

 

 

 

ولك جزيل الشكر

برنامج الحسابات.rar

تم تعديل بواسطه ابـو فـيـصـل
رابط هذا التعليق
شارك

السلام عليكم

 

تم عمل المجاميع لكل الحسابات وتعديل كود اسماء الشيتات في ورقة قائمة الاسماء

وتم عمل المجاميع بين تاريخين للفواتير والسندات (لورقة واحدة حسب الاختيار) في ورقة حسابات - تقديرات

 

شاهد المرفق 2003

برنامج الحسابات.rar

  • Like 1
رابط هذا التعليق
شارك

الاستاذ: عبدالله باقشير

 

يعلم الله اني دعوت لك عندما رأيت الرد وقبل ان احمل التعديلا

 

فأسئل الله الكريم رب العرش العظيم أن يجزاك الخير الكثير

 

وأن يوفقك دنيا وآخرة ,وأن يرزقك من حيث لاتحتسب

 

 

الرد قبل التحميل عرفاناً بجميلك

 

دمت بخير وسعادة

 

تقبل تحياتي

رابط هذا التعليق
شارك

الاستاذ: عبدالله باقشير

 

كيف يمكن جعل القائمة المنسدلة في ورقة ادخال البيانات و الترحيل

 

بحيث عند كتابة اول حرف او حرفين يختصر القائمة في الاسماء التي تبدأ بتلك الحروف

 

وكذلك الفرغات الموجوده اسفل القائمة نقوم بإلغائها

 

دمت بخير

رابط هذا التعليق
شارك

السلام عليكم

 

تعبتكم باستفساراتي ولديكم مشاغلكم

 

ولكن العذر لعدم درايتي الكاملة بالاكسل الذي حببني في منتداكم وروح تعاونكم

 

 

** لازال هناك نقاط لاكمال العمل **

 

منها

 

**  عند ترحيل فاتورة كاش لكشف مندوب هناك فواتير آجلة طبعاً

 

كيف يمكنني التفريق بين الكاش والآجل عند طباعة  او مراجعة الحساب

 

 

 

دمتم بخير

 

وتقبلو تحياتي

رابط هذا التعليق
شارك

 

السلام عليكم

 

تعبتكم باستفساراتي ولديكم مشاغلكم

 

ولكن العذر لعدم درايتي الكاملة بالاكسل الذي حببني في منتداكم وروح تعاونكم

 

 

** لازال هناك نقاط لاكمال العمل **

 

منها

 

**  عند ترحيل فاتورة كاش لكشف مندوب هناك فواتير آجلة طبعاً

 

كيف يمكنني التفريق بين الكاش والآجل عند طباعة  او مراجعة الحساب

 

 

 

دمتم بخير

 

وتقبلو تحياتي

 

 

وعليكم السلام

تم تعديل كود الترحيل ليقوم بترحيل نوع الفاتورة الى  العمود  A في الحساب المرحل له

 

شاهد المرفق 2003

برنامج الحسابات.rar

رابط هذا التعليق
شارك

أسعدك الله بساعات هذا اليوم المبارك
ووسع عليك رزقك والهمك ذكره
وأجاب دعوتك وزادك من فضله
وحفظ دينك وأيدك بنصره
ورضي عنك وأرضاك من حبه
وعن النار أبعدك وأدخلك جنته
وللخير أرشدك

 

ولكل مسلم ومسلمه

 

تقبل تحياتي

دمت بخير

 

ر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• اضف...

Important Information